Flagship on schedule with Totalmobile

Flagship Group has taken on a suite of software from Totalmobile, covering work-order management, workforce scheduling, mobile working and field-service intelligence. Totalmobile’s platform is intended to give the housing provider a flexible approach to real-time updates on service requests, problem reporting and resource requests. Totalmobile’s 135,000 lone-worker alerts

Totalmobile’s software for protecting lone workers has handled 135,000 alerts from its 100,000 users in the past year. Totalmobile’s team dealt with around 370 alerts per day in 2023, from lone workers in the public, commercial and property sectors across the UK and Ireland who felt they were in danger and/or facing an imminent threat….
